Maryland Pumpkin Seeds

SUBMITTED BY: jolly_holly PHOTO BY: Lillian

"Toasted pumpkin seeds with Maryland's favorite seasoning!"
PREP TIME  10 Min
COOK TIME  30 Min
READY IN  40 Min
Original recipe yield 1 1/2 cups

INGREDIENTS (Nutrition)

  • 4 cups raw pumpkin seeds
  • 1/4 cup seafood seasoning, such as Old Bay™
  • vegetable oil cooking spray

DIRECTIONS

  1. Preheat the o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C). Rinse pumpkin seeds in a colander. Spread out on paper towels and pat dry.
  2. Coat a large baking sheet with cooking spray and spread the pumpkin seeds out in a single layer. Spray the tops of the seeds with additional cooking spray. Sprinkle the seafood seasoning evenly over the tops.
  3. Bake for 30 minutes in the preheated oven, stirring occasionally, until dry and toasted. Cool for a few minutes before serving.
